299.95
Regular price
389.95
On Sale
299.95
Regular price
389.95
On Sale
299.95
Regular price
389.95
On Sale
299.95
Regular price
389.95
On Sale
299.95
Regular price
389.95
On Sale
299.95
Regular price
389.95
On Sale
299.95
Regular price
389.95
On Sale
299.95
Regular price
389.95
On Sale
299.95
Regular price
389.95
On Sale